A friendly face at the start of someone's Australian journey
Arriving in a new country is exciting — and overwhelming. Welcome Desk is a student-led volunteer program where trained LIVE in Australia volunteers meet newly arrived international students at Sydney Airport, point them toward transport and accommodation, and help them feel less alone in their first hour on the ground.
It's a small act with a big impact: a warm hello, clear information, and the reassurance that there's a community here ready to help them thrive.

Your role on the day
Welcome arrivals
Meet newly arrived students as they land in Sydney.
First-point support
Answer questions about transport, SIM cards, and getting around.
Help them settle
Make sure no one feels lost or alone on day one.
Work as a team
Run shifts alongside other student volunteers and mentors.
Get trained first
Complete a short onboarding before your first shift.
Represent LIVE
Be the friendly face of the student community.
